Game Focus Statement
Chemical Chords is intended to be an educational game, allowing the player to portray a musician at the start of his carreer. This character is created and customized by the player, because the player should be totally immersed into the game experience by being able to identify with his character. 

The game has no finite goal, but serves as a virtual stage for the player. What is needed for the character to become a successful, renowned artist? Chemical Chords does not concern itself with really learning a musical instrument, but tries to foster the interest in music, and experience the troubles an upstart artist might get in.

Our theme for the game (educational focus) is Music.
Our game will be a Role-Playing / Social Adventure Game.

The player will be portraying a young musician at the start of his/her career. The character will live through a lot of conflicts and situations, that are typicial of the Music and Artist environment. We want our game to be very dynamic with a high replay value. You could play a good-looking female singer, a worn-out songwriter who can barely play chords on his guitar or a crazy metal-head.
